Weather in February

With February's arrival, Shabling sees a subtle shift in climatic conditions, which involves an increase in temperatures and a decrease in snowfall. Compared to both January and March, this central winter month sees the most snowfall which peaks at 146mm (5.75"), turning the city into a winter wonderland. Increasing rainfall and evaporating snow begin to presage the spring, yet the weather remains predominantly cold. More variability in weather conditions can be expected in the upcoming month of March as the city transitions into spring.

Temperature

Shabling records an average high-temperature of a frosty 7.6°C (45.7°F) in February, closely mirroring the climate of the previous month. The low-temperature average for Shabling during February stands at a freezing cold -1.1°C (30°F).

Humidity

January and February, with an average relative humidity of 57%, are the least humid months in Shabling.

Rainfall

In Shabling, during February, the rain falls for 4.9 days and regularly aggregates up to 21mm (0.83") of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 186.7 rainfall days, and 863mm (33.98")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through May, November and December are months with snowfall. February is the month with the most snowfall in Shabling. Snow falls for 7.8 days and accumulates 146mm (5.75") of snow.

Daylight

In Shabling, the average length of the day in February is 11h and 13min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:42 and sunset at 17:35. On the last day of February, in Shabling, sunrise is at 06:20 and sunset at 17:55 +06.

Sunshine

January, February and November, with an average of 7.4h of sunshine, are months with the least sunshine.

UV index

January, February and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index in Shabling, Bhutan.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a low threat to health from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: The average daily UV index of 2 in February transforms into the following instructions:
Most individuals face no significant issues with extended sun exposure, but it is always essential to protect children, babies, and those with sensitive skin. Solar radiation is at its peak intensity during midday, so it's advisable to stay indoors or in the shade. For minimizing sun-related eye damage, always choose sunglasses with UVA and UVB coverage. Note this! The Sun's UV radiation can nearly be doubled by the reflection off snow.
